Server Shipment Momentum to Cloud Holds Steady in 3Q17, According to Dell’Oro Group

Shipments to Cloud Grow Over 20 Percent Year-Over-Year for Seventh Consecutive Quarter

REDWOOD CITY, Calif., Dec. 11, 2017 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- According to a recently published report from Dell’Oro Group, the trusted source for market information about the telecommunications, networks, and data center IT industries, server shipment momentum to the Cloud held steady in 3Q17 with shipments growing over 20 percent year-over-year (Y/Y) for the seventh consecutive quarter.

“This momentum to the Cloud is driven by the Intel Purley refresh cycle and the need to invest in the latest machine learning technologies as workloads continue to migrate from the Enterprise to the Cloud,” said Baron Fung, Senior Business Analysis Manager at Dell’Oro Group. “Turning to the Enterprise, we saw Enterprise server revenue grow in the quarter. However, the growth was driven by higher systems prices as memory costs continues to climb. Although it benefitted the market this quarter, we believe memory prices will hurt Enterprise demand in 2018 as end-users pause purchases until memory pricing stabilizes,” continued Fung.

Additional highlights from the 3Q17 Server Quarterly Report:

  • Cloud data center spending is projected to be strong for the rest the year and into 2018. Server shipments to the Cloud are primarily from White box vendors, who are seeing their revenue and shipments hit all-time highs.
  • Shipments for four of the top five OEM server vendors declined Y/Y. This was due to the continued server migration from the Enterprise to the Cloud and the aforementioned memory pricing. Dell was the only top five OEM server vendor to grow server shipments Y/Y.

About the Report
Dell’Oro Group’s Server Quarterly Report provides complete, in-depth coverage of the market with tables covering manufacturers’ revenue, unit, and port shipments for Blade, High-Density and Stand-Alone servers. Network attach rates, virtualization attach rates and VM density, common equipment overlap between storage, servers and switching, and white box versus traditional enterprise server shipments are included.
